Excerpt from Common Sense in Politics More nonsense has been written and orated on the subject of American politics during the past ten years than in any decade of the nation's history. In Spite of this, much progress has been made. Important legisla tion has been effected, rights protected, rem edies established, and a general betterment brought about. While these results were being accomplished the country has been treated to the most remarkable outpouring of heated discussion, denunciation, and dis crediting of motives that has ever been in dulged in in so short a time. Excerpt from The Cuban Question and American Policy, in the Light of Common Sense The fate of Cuba rests with the United States. The Cubans have struck the blow for freedom, and for more than a year have maintained a most heroic struggle. Without effective arras or munitions of war, and without organization, preparation, or military training, they bravely proclaimed their liberty, risking their lives, property, and all they hold dear for that inestimable blessing. They were goaded to this step by intolerable tyranny and grinding exactions. They had no voice in the government over them; they were heavily taxed without their consent; they had no control over the enormous revenue exacted from them; they had not only to support a host of hungry officials in the island, who were sent out from Spain, and who had no sympathy with the colonists or interest in the colony, but they were compelled also to contribute largely to the support of their oppressors and of that very government in Europe which denied them even the shadow of political liberty. No people ever had greater cause for revolt. None ever behaved more bravely, and, considering their want of means, the difficulties they labored under, and the vast organized military power against them, none ever made greater success, within so short a period. Yet, if unaided, directly or indirectly, by the United States, the conflict must be long and doubtful, and would only end with the utter ruin of the island. Hence, as was said, the fate of Cuba rests with this country. The Cubans may maintain the struggle to the bitter end, and, no doubt, have made up their minds to do so. The die is cast, and it would be better to suffer death in the effort to be free than to be subjugated, for Spain is cruel and unforgiving. Excerpt from Common Sense Applied to Woman Suffrage Today, also, the protest, the declaration of independence, does not receive the unanimous support of the classes on whose behalf it is made. There are Tories in the midst, and plan sible reasons are advanced even by women, against the demand made for them, to be allowed to take, among the powers of the earth, the separate and equal place to which the laws of Nature and of Nature's God entitle them. Interested men who are not to be trusted, weak men who cannot see, prejudiced men who will not see, and a certain set of moderate men who think better of the European world than it deserves, are those who espouse the doctrine of reconciliation. And today, as in 1776, the demand to emerge into political individuality, from a condition of political non-existence, - the demand to become recognized factors in the political life of the State, implies, and also forebodes changes in the social status of those demanding, which is of far more consequence than any of the special reasons which may be urged in support of the demand. Enormously popular and widely read pamphlet, first published in January of 1776, clearly and persuasively argues for American separation from Great Britain and paves the way for the Declaration of Independence. This highly influential landmark document attacks the monarchy, cites the evils of government and combines idealism with practical economic concerns.

Excerpt from Common-Sense in Law In view of these obvious considerations, I should like to explain as briefly and simply as possible the main principles which underlie legal arrangements. Although the details of legal rules are complicated and technical, the Operations of the mind in the domain of law are based on common sense, and may be followed without difficulty by persons of ordinary intelligence and education. Juris prudence may be likened in this respect to political economy, which also is developed from simple general principles and yet re quires a great deal of special knowledge when it comes to particulars.
